Group 1 - Chery Automobile has received approval from the China Securities Regulatory Commission for its Hong Kong IPO and the "full circulation" of unlisted shares, allowing the issuance of up to 698,922,800 overseas listed shares and the conversion of 2,015,999,074 unlisted shares for trading in Hong Kong [1] - This move marks a significant step in Chery's international capital operations, broadening financing channels and enhancing its capital structure and R&D capabilities, which may serve as a model for asset securitization in the automotive sector [1] - The liquidity of the Hong Kong new energy vehicle sector is expected to improve, potentially attracting more high-quality domestic car companies to explore overseas financing opportunities, thereby enhancing the overall competitiveness of China's automotive industry in international capital markets [1] Group 2 - SAIC Motor has opened its first "Wuling + MG" dual-brand experience center in Jakarta, Indonesia, marking a significant step in its overseas market strategy [2] - The establishment of this center is part of a comprehensive operational system in Indonesia that includes manufacturing, supply, sales, finance, and talent development, enhancing brand synergy and deepening market penetration in Southeast Asia [2] - This initiative is expected to accelerate the innovation of overseas channels and local integration for Chinese car manufacturers, ultimately boosting the global competitiveness of Chinese manufacturing [2] Group 3 - Avita Technology has announced a patent for a low-power control method for vehicles, aimed at maintaining battery health while minimizing static current [3] - This technology is designed to enhance product endurance and user experience without compromising basic vehicle functions, reflecting ongoing innovation in core technologies within the new energy vehicle sector [3] - The focus on technological breakthroughs in the new energy vehicle industry may drive companies to strengthen their patent portfolios, improving product competitiveness and contributing to high-quality industry development [3] Group 4 - Xiaomi Auto's vice president responded to concerns regarding the payment process for the YU7 vehicle, indicating the company's commitment to user experience and customer relationship management [4] - This quick response to customer inquiries is expected to enhance brand image and consumer trust, setting a positive example for customer service standards in the new energy vehicle sector [4] - The automotive sector's increasing focus on optimizing after-sales service systems may lead to improved service standards and stronger user engagement, supporting the sustainable development of the new energy vehicle market [4]
